Definitions:

Osler Nodes

Red, painful, elevated sores on the hands and feet linked to infectious endocarditis.

Janeway Spots

Small, painless, red or purple spots on the palms or soles, associated with infective endocarditis.

Analgesics

Medications designed specifically to relieve pain without causing the loss of consciousness.

Rheumatic Fever

An inflammatory disease that can develop after a Group A Streptococcus bacterial infection, potentially damaging heart valves and other tissues.
